The trend of wearing real bug jewellery became popular in the Victorian period.
People were fascinated with the new discoveries of foreign lands, exotic animals and bugs during this time.
As urbanisation grew, the Victorians become more detached from nature, so using bugs and animals as adornment was a way to bring them a little closer to nature again!
